Synchronous and Asynchronous Buses
  • Synchronous Buses
    • includes a clock in the control lines
    • uses a protocol relative to the clock
    • every device on the bus must have the same clock rate
    • must be short to avoid clock skew problems
  • Asynchronous Buses
    • does not use a clock
    • uses a handshaking protocol
    • can accommodate devices running at different speeds
Chapter 8: Interfacing Processors and Peripherals - 22 of 29